Introduction to Jinzhai Cuimei
Jinzhai Cuimei is produced in Jinzhai County, Anhui Province and is one of the famous teas in China. This tea grows in the Jinzhai Mountain area, a national ecological demonstration zone, where the mountains are high, forests are dense, clouds and mist are pervasive, air humidity is high, and annual rainfall is sufficient, providing a good natural environment for tea production. What's even more peculiar is that around the bat cave, thousands of bats gather here all year round, and the feces they scatter are rich in phosphorus, which is conducive to the growth of tea trees. Therefore, it not only has natural conditions such as warm climate and soft soil in general tea areas, but also has the characteristics of high mountains, deep valleys, clouds like the sea, low humidity between streams, steep cliffs and slopes, short sunshine, and lush forests with good soil and water. In addition, the tea area is dotted with fruit, bamboo, flowers, and trees, with a variety of plants coexisting and abundant diffuse light, forming the unique quality of the tea leaves inside "Jinzhai Cuimei" is characterized by its uniform shape, emerald green color, and firm appearance when soaked. Its soup color is clear and green, and it is sweet and refreshing to drink. It has a strong and long-lasting fragrance, which has the effects of refreshing and strengthening the stomach, clearing heat and detoxifying, weight loss and anti-aging. This special Cuimei was picked about a week before Qingming Festival, with tender and fresh buds, consistent picking size, and special processing requirements. Therefore, it is not recommended to use 100 degree boiling water for brewing. High temperature boiling water will scald the tender buds, slightly turbid soup color, and damage the nutrition of the tea. It is recommended to use 80 degree boiling water.
